SNS 050: From Despair to Praise, One Man's Journey. Psalm 22, Psalm Tuesday

God, where are you? Have you ever asked this question? If you’re like me, then you have… at least once. And the good news is that we are not alone. In this episode we hear the Psalmist ask the very same thing. Indeed, we are privileged to get a glimpse into the journey he takes from despair, through reflection on God, on to an honest pouring out of his heart concerning his plight and then, arriving at a very interesting destination. Once God answers, the Psalmist is quick to let go the despair and begin to loudly praise God, the destination is joy in God. It is an honest journey through pain into the joy of acceptance and celebration of God’s answer. What an amazing journey to make.

SNS 049: The Majesty of God Involves Blessing Others. Psalm 21, Psalm Tuesday

What comes to mind when you think of someone being majestic and full of dignity? One who is well dressed, powerful, and highly influential? In this episode, the Psalmist gives us an unexpected insight into what a life of majesty and dignity truly is. It is a life that is a continual source of blessing for others. Being a blessing to others is part of the majesty of God; a majesty he imparts to those who love him. How mind-blowing is that?

SNS 046: Treated as You Treat Others, Psalm 18, Psalm Tuesday

In this episode, the Psalmist says many things. But there are two things which stand out to me: 1st:  

With the strong, and the blameless, and the honest man,

You prove yourself blameless and honest.

Yet, to those who are violent,

 You will act violently.

And with the twisted and the false,

You prove full of twists and turns.

For you help the humble,

But the arrogant you humiliate.

 

That God treats people for who they are. Isn’t that intriguing. And 2nd is that a life of faith is reliance on God while we are doing things. The life of faith isn’t a life waiting around for magic to happen, for a fairy god-father to wave his wand and presto all is right. It is a faith where you work things out, as you do what you can, and simultaneously trusting God to take care of what you cannot. Faith in God is not to be a lazy faith. Well…
